原创 教你如何选择STM32 开发板[转载]

2009-6-16 09:05 5802 10 11 分类: MCU/ 嵌入式

教你如何选择 STM32 开发板<?xml:namespace prefix = o ns = "urn:schemas-microsoft-com:office:office" />


转载:ouravr

   
目前我们接触的到的网上的关于 STM32 开发板大约有 4 种,有适合 STM32 入门级的开发者,也有适合对于高级应用开发的工程师们的。


因此对于不同的人群我们应该选择不同的开发板,面对 4 种我们都没有使用的开发板,手里的银子也不可以乱用,明显我们只要选择其中的一块来满足我们的需要,那我们该怎么去选择呢?我想我们应该先对板子的概况进行了解。

先列出我们要介绍的 4 款开发板的型号:


* 英蓓特STM32V100开发板http://www.realview.com.cn/list.asp?id=275
*
英蓓特STM32R100开发板http://arm.embedinfo.com/list.asp?id=281
* EK-STM
系列仿真学习套件


http://www.realview.com.cn/down-class.asp?Page=3
*
智林公司出品 STM32 开发套件


http://www.the0.net/chinese/news.asp?keyno=27

==============================================================


各类资源综合比较,评估:
价格比较:
*
英蓓特STM32V100开发板  800/套,送ST-LINK仿真器, 适合再次开发利用
*
英蓓特STM32R100开发板  292/套,没有送仿真器
* EK-STM
系列仿真学习套件  399/套,内嵌ST-LINK II仿真器,不宜再次开发利用
*
智林公司出品 STM32 开发套件  318/套,没有送仿真器

资源比较:


* 英蓓特STM32V100  开发板资源最丰富,来源于官方, Realview
*
英蓓特STM32R100    开发板资源一般,来源于官方, Realview
* EK-STM
系列仿真学习套件 万利电子有限公司, 基本没有什么例程,可以参照上面第一款开发板的程序
*
智林公司出品 STM32 开发套件    资源为智林公司出品,基本是 copy 官方的资源,且需要购买开发板才赠送

适合人群比较:
*
英蓓特STM32V100开发板   采用 STM<?xml:namespace prefix = st1 ns = "urn:schemas-microsoft-com:office:smarttags" />32F103VBT6芯片*72MHz128KB Flash20KB SRAM)适合高级应用工程师
*
英蓓特STM32R100开发板    采用 STM32F103RB芯片*72MHz128KB Flash20KB SRAM)适合高级应用工程师
* EK-STM
系列仿真学习套件    采用 STM32F103VBH6芯片*72MHz128KB Flash20KB SRAM)适合入门级用户
*
智林公司出品 STM32 开发套件    采用 STM32F103RB芯片*72MHz128KB Flash20KB SRAM)性价比不高,适合公司用户

技术支持比较:
*
英蓓特STM32V100开发板    官方技术支持,可以通过 ST 代理,适合企业用户。
*
英蓓特STM32R100开发板    官方技术支持,可以通过 ST 代理,适合企业用户。
* EK-STM
系列仿真学习套件    万利公司技术支持,适合企业用户,但这个板子普及率目前较高,网上可搜到一些教程。
*
智林公司出品 STM32 开发套件    智林公司技术支持,可通过 E-mail 交流。


===========================================================
1
  英蓓特STM32V100开发板

功能描述:STM103V100评估板有USB, Motor Control , CAN, SD卡,Smart 卡,UARTSpeakerLCDLEDBNC,耳塞插孔等丰富的外设,有助于用户轻松开发STM32的强大功能

STM103V100
评估板最大特色是板上集成了英蓓特公司uLinkMe仿真调试电路,板子自动对仿真器进行识别选择,用户只须一根USB线即可进行调试,另外STM103V100评估板还支持JTAGSWD串行调试方式

含有丰富的RealView MDK下的例程代码:(下载地址:


http://www.realview.com.cn/down-class.asp
* ADC
模数转换例程
* LCD_SPI
显示例程,可显示字符、文字、图形等信息
* LED
例程,控制LED指示灯,提供跑马灯演示程序
*
串口通讯例程,可以与PC或其它外设通讯,也可以做相互通讯实验
* USBAudio/DAC
转换例程,可通过USB接口将音频数据发送到板,在板上进行DAC解码输出音频,实现USB声卡例程
* USBHID
例程,实现USB转串口的功能
* USBCDC
例程,可通过USB接口虚拟串口设备
*  
支持MMC/SD卡,提供SD/MMC卡驱动程序,可实现读卡器功能
* GPIO
的控制实验,LED(发光二极管)KEY(按键)
* RTX_Blinky
例程,在RTX内核上运行的步进电机仿真驱动程序
* CAN
实验
* DMA
通信实验例程
* Flash
读写、存储例程
* LED
控制例程,提供跑马等程序
* SPI
总线通信例程
* SYSTICK
五维摇杆按键例程
* DEBUG
仿真模拟调试例程
* EXTI
芯片中断实验调用配置例程
* RCC
芯片内部时钟管理程序
* RTC
实时时钟程序
* WWDG
看门狗实验例程
* BKP
备份寄存器例程
*
时钟波形配置实验例程TIM
*
中断向量配置实验例程NVIC
* irDA
红外通信收发例程
* PWR
电源管理程序
* LCD_1620
单色显色屏控制程序
*
摇杆按键控制程序joystick
* CortexM3
利用CortexM3的位块管理功能来读写SRAM中的变量程序
* Tsensor
数字温度传感器程序
* Mass_Storage
利用USB通信来实现SD卡接口与USB接口的转换
* STM32F10x_Smartcard_AN
提供SMARTcard调试程序
*
基于STM32V100ucos下的直流电机驱动例程


http://www.realview.com.cn/down-list.asp?id=347  

-------------------------------------------------------------------------------

2
英蓓特STM32R100开发板

Embest STM32
开发套件硬件参数:
*
采用STSTM32F103RB芯片*72MHz128KB Flash20KB SRAM2×SPI,2×I2C,USBCANPWM2×ADC3×USART
*
工业级设计,可稳定运行于 -40 到 85 摄氏度
* 1
个串口 1CAN端口 1USB接口 1个可调模拟电压控制用于ADC输入,1SD卡插槽 JTAG下载与调试

RealView MDK
下的例程如下:(下载地址:


http://www.realview.com.cn/down-class.asp?Page=2
* STM32R100
的串口程序
* STM32R100
TIM程序
* STM32R100
SPI程序
* STM32R100
RCC程序
* STM32R100
PWR程序
* STM32R100
NVIC程序
* STM32R100
LED程序
* STM32R100
Flash程序
* STM32R100
DMA程序
* STM32R100
CAN程序
* STM32R100
Blinky程序
* STM32R100
ADC程序

-------------------------------------------------------------------------------
3
EK-STM系列仿真学习套件
  
功能描述:EK-STM系列仿真学习套件有两个RS232 ,一个B USB,一个CAN ,一个SD 卡座,1 LCD 显示,1 I2C24C02),四个LED 发光管,一路电位器输入模拟信号,一个五方向输入摇杆,两个GPIO 按键  
供电方式:评估系统USB 端口供电

软件例程:暂无,可以参照英蓓特STM32V100开发板
RealView MDK
下的例程如下:(下载地址:http://www.realview.com.cn/down-class.asp?Page=3

-------------------------------------------------------------------------------
4
智林公司出品 STM32 开发套件

功能描述:智林公司出品 STM32 开发套件有一个RS232 ,一个B USB,一个CAN ,一个SD 卡座, 1 160x128图形点阵彩色 TFT LCD1 I2C24C02),一路电位器输入模拟信号,一个五方向输入摇杆,一个扬声器
仿真接口:标准 20 JTAG口,用于下载与调试

软件例程:(不提供下载,需购买开发板光盘附送)
* GPIO
试验一:输出
*
昀简单的例子,点亮 LED
*
点亮液晶背光:PWM试验
*
PWM驱动液晶背光升压电路,因为是硬件的 PWM,所以只要设置好后不占用 CPU资源,又简化了硬件。
*
点亮液晶屏
*
使用 GPIO模拟液晶的硬件时序来驱动液晶。例子:
*
显示英文字符串
*
显示汉字
*
显示位图 BMP
*
输入实验错误!未定义书签。
*
游戏  
* GPIO
试验二:输入
* ADC
试验
*
使用板上的电位器来改变 ADC的输入电压。
* PWM
输出试验:电子琴
*
使用定时器的 PWM功能驱动扬声器,通过改变 ADC电位器,发出不同频率的声音。
*
读写板上的 I2C器件 24C02
*
模拟一个 U盘。
* SD
卡试验
*
移植了开源文件系统 FatFS STM32
*
串口通信试验


—UART0查询方式


—UART0中断方式
* CAN
总线收发实验。
*
定时器试验:使用中断方式
* RTC
试验
*
外部中断试验
*
入侵检测试验
*
看门狗试验
*
观察开启看门狗后,如果不喂狗的复位情况。
*
软件中断试验
*
实时操作系统 uC/OS-II的基本实验,开启 2个任务

PARTNER CONTENT

文章评论1条评论)

登录后参与讨论

coyoo 2013-3-12 11:38

试了一下,“去除所有属性”还是超9000多字;而且这样就算不超版面也不好看了!

coyoo 2013-3-12 11:25

是吗?关键是我用高级编辑导入word文档进去,在我点提交之前并未提醒我超字数,提交之后告诉我超了字数。而且超的很离谱,呵呵

用户403664 2013-3-12 09:14

用高级编辑器的一键排版功能就不会超过字数了~

caiziyingtianxia1985_564124490 2009-9-29 09:28

我也想学STM32了,但我看了打算买MEDWIN 的那款199的板子入门+jlink 不知道怎么样?
相关推荐阅读
藤井树 2015-10-12 14:43
印制电路板的抗干扰设计 zz
印制电路板的抗干扰设计     作者:中船重工集团第707所 肖麟芬   摘   要:本文以印制电路板的电磁兼容性为核心,分析了电磁干扰的产生机理...
藤井树 2013-10-22 15:32
2010.5.30 黄草梁上包饺子一日登山活动——摘韭菜篇
        上次桃花节的时候也有野韭菜,那时候的我连草和韭菜叶分不清,才回去的韭菜也不敢吃,哈哈,这次可算真正见识了韭菜,黄草梁也叫韭菜梁,因为满山遍野都是野韭菜而闻名,比较圆比较粗的就是野韭...
藤井树 2013-10-22 15:28
2010.5.30 黄草梁上包饺子一日登山活动——包饺子篇
摘韭菜回来,大家已经忙开了 我也装模作样地“工作着” 哈哈,还不让我包,包饺子是技术活,一定要皮薄馅厚才有资格包,像我这样的只能旁观了 摘的韭菜应该足够了,旁边那个袋子是我摘来带回学校的 ...
藤井树 2013-08-09 15:19
datasheet下载网站整理(查IC芯片手册)【原创】
*************************************************************************         作为电子工程师,芯片的dat...
藤井树 2010-06-04 00:21
陈伟宁王辉一家捐助渠道(北京菲亚特—英菲尼迪)
       王辉的最新消息请关注 http://chenweining.org/       目前事故责任认定已经出来了——陈家全责。        发信人: program (程序), 信区: D...
藤井树 2010-06-01 13:43
2010.5.30 黄草梁上包饺子一日登山活动——美景篇
这天不得不说的是天空,蓝蓝的天空,白白的云    绿油油的山脊  我、洪涛哥哥、huangna妹妹还有她同事小艾走在黄草梁上    在蓝天白云下合影       阳光照过来,景色真美 象鼻山,走不...
EE直播间
更多
我要评论
1
10
关闭 站长推荐上一条 /3 下一条